Welcome to Captain Python’s Historical Research Center. This thread is dedicated to research of life from the early 17th Century to the mid 18th Century. A lot of this research will be used on Captain Python’s High Seas Game Idea, Project Name Merchants and Pirates. Here is a link:http://forum.piratesahoy.net/ftopic1490.php
Here are some things that will be and have been researched:
